Domestic violence and abuse arise from the desire to acquire and maintain power and control over intimate partners. Abusive people think that they have the right to control and restrict their partners, and they may feel the power to give them. They think that their emotions and needs should be the top priority of their relationship, so they exclude equality, they do not make their partners feel value and are worth respecting relationships .
Abuse is learning behavior. Sometimes people see it at their own house. In other times, they learn from friends and pop culture. But abuse is an option not everyone has to do. Many people experiencing or witnessing abuse grow and decide not to use negative and harmful behavior in their relationship. External factors such as drugs and alcoholism may expand abuse, but the most important thing is to recognize that these problems do not lead to abuse.
Everyone can insult and everyone can be a victim of abuse. This happens regardless of sex, age, sexual orientation, ethnicity, or economic background.
